The RGB setting gives drastically different pictures when set.
I personally use RGB set to full (full enables deep blacks and vibrant colors). Limited is a bit too washed out for my liking.
The long and short of it is that the Full setting expands the intensity range of the output signal by 10% in both ends of the spectrum. If your TV supports the option to use the RGB Full Range in the "full" setting this will result in the best colors, whites and blacks.
